About Lumafield:
Founded in 2019, Lumafield has developed the world's first accessible X-Ray CT scanner for engineers. Our easy-to-use scanner and cloud-based software give engineers the ability to see their work clearly, inside and out, at an extremely affordable price.
Engineers make million-dollar decisions every day, and they need tools that give them the greatest possible insight into their products. By offering unprecedented visibility into products, as well as AI-driven tools that highlight problems and generate quantitative data, Lumafield promises to revolutionize the way complex products are created, manufactured, and used across industries.
We are an impact driven company obsessed with providing the best value to our customers keeping their needs at the center of our evolution. Our team today includes world-class researchers and industrial designers, PhDs, creators, founders of successful startups, and zero egos. We are backed by top venture capital funds like Kleiner Perkins, Lux Capital, DCVC, Spark Capital, and others.
The company is headquartered in Cambridge, MA and has an office in San Francisco, CA.
About the role:
As a Senior Embedded Systems Engineer at Lumafield, you will work on the software that powers our next-generation, manufacturing in-line CT scanning products. You’ll work on the bleeding edge of X-ray physics, high-speed detectors, image processing, and embedded systems. On a small team working on our newest hardware, you’ll bring the skill to extract the maximum performance out of the system and achieve great outcomes for our customers.
This role is ideal for candidates who are looking for an opportunity to own the embedded system, firmware and software design on an early-stage new product.
This role is located in Lumafield’s San Francisco, CA office. You may be required to travel occasionally to Lumafield’s Cambridge, MA office.
Write performance edge application software to acquire, process, and stream radiograph data
Write appliance firmware to maintain tight control loops for scanner peripherals
Participate in code reviews, build up testing infrastructure, and help set a high standard for how the team can move fast and maintain high levels of quality.
Ship production critical Linux-based applications
Architect data acquisition solutions that balance configurability and customizability
Collaborate closely with our product, research, hardware, and software development teams to understand requirements and architect solutions
3+ years of experience writing low-level, high-performance software in Python and C; you not only write code, but also understand the performance impact on a specific system
3+ years of experience shipping applications with embedded Linux, including configuring core services such as udev, systemd, and kernel schedulers
3+ years of startup experience – you know the trade-offs between shipping fast and perfecting a design
Experience writing firmware with STM32 microcontrollers or equivalent
Experience with managing the software release lifecycle for a fleet of edge/IoT devices using industry-standard OTA update mechanisms, including fleet status and monitoring
Mastery of software engineering fundamentals including debuggers, profilers, and evaluating trade-offs between different technology choices, and proficiency with Python’s built-in concurrency models (asyncio, threading, and multiprocessing)
Basic familiarity with electrical engineering concepts including schematic layout, PCBA
design, bring-up, and testing
Able to design, integrate, and test systems by interpreting component and product datasheets
Bachelor's degree in Engineering or related field
Experience building & shipping high performance hardware-accelerated image processing edge solutions using NVIDIA CUDA and/or Jetson platform
Experience with classical computer vision techniques and machine learning CV algorithms
Experience with microcontroller-based motor control
Experience with shipping user-facing UIs written in React.js
